>> i have observed the following with qemu-kvm-1.2.0 which I think is not right:
>> 
>> a) if the CDROM is locked and I sent a eject command I get the error that the
>> CDROM is locked, but its ejected nevertheless.
> 
> That's because the CD-ROM sends an "eject requested" event, and udev
> does the unlock & eject itself.

ah ok, this explains it.

> 
>> b) if I eject the CDROM in the OS I see tray-open=1 and locked=1. In the
>> tray-open=1 state the CDROM can`t be locked, can it?
> 
> A "real" CD-ROM drive could have the tray open and not responding to the
> button.  Table 330 of MMC6 matches "Operation Lock, current prevent
> state Locked, No media present" to "No Error, media insertion is not
> permitted".  I cannot check right now what happens later and whether
> QEMU's behavior makes sense.

okay, so this could be also correct.
